Product Type Digital compact camera
Model VPC-S122EX
Brand Sanyo
Sensor Resolution 12.2 megapixels
Optical Zoom 3x
Digital Zoom 4x
LCD Display 2.7 inch TFT
Storage Media SD/SDHC memory card
Battery Type Lithium-ion rechargeable (NP-80 or equivalent)
Dimensions (W x H x D) 95 x 60 x 25 mm
Weight (without battery) Approx. 105 g
Interface USB 2.0, AV out
Main Functions Still image capture, video recording (Motion JPEG, 640x480), playback, face detection, scene modes
Maintenance Clean lens with soft, dry cloth; store in dry place
Safety Notes Avoid exposure to water, extreme temperatures; do not disassemble
Spare Parts Available Replacement battery, battery charger, USB cable, memory cards
Repairability User-replaceable battery and memory card; other repairs by qualified service

Frequently Asked Questions - VPC-S122EX SANYO

How do I transfer photos from the camera to my computer?
Connect the camera to your computer using the supplied USB cable. Turn on the camera and it should be recognized as a removable drive. You can then copy photos directly. Alternatively, remove the memory card and use a card reader.
What type of memory card does the Sanyo VPC-S122EX use?
The camera supports SD and SDHC memory cards. It is recommended to use cards up to 32GB capacity. Ensure the card is formatted in the camera before first use.
How long does the battery last?
The battery life is approximately 200 shots under typical conditions. It is advisable to carry a spare battery for extended use.
Can I record videos with this camera?
Yes, the VPC-S122EX can record video in Motion JPEG format at 640x480 resolution. Audio is also recorded.
How do I reset the camera?
To reset the camera, go to the setup menu and select 'Reset All' or sometimes 'Factory Settings'. Alternatively, remove the battery and memory card for a few minutes.
Why are my photos blurry?
Blurry photos can result from camera shake, slow shutter speed, or incorrect focus. Use the anti-shake feature if available, ensure proper lighting, and hold the camera steady. In low light, use a tripod.
How do I clean the lens?
Use a soft, lint-free cloth (like a microfiber cloth) to gently wipe the lens. Do not use any cleaning solutions or abrasive materials. A lens brush can remove dust first.
The camera won't turn on. What should I do?
First, check the battery: ensure it is charged and properly inserted. If the battery is low, recharge it. Try a different battery if available. If the camera still does not power on, the battery contacts may need cleaning.
Can I use the camera while charging?
No, the camera cannot be used while the battery is charging via the USB cable. Charge the battery separately or use an external charger.
How many scene modes are available?
The camera offers several scene modes like Portrait, Landscape, Night Scene, Sports, and more. Select the appropriate mode for the shooting condition to optimize settings.
